When I first arrived at Cortland and saw dance as an activity class, I thought it was a joke. But once I completed the course last spring, it showed me that there are so many different aspects of physical education in dance. If you do a high speed dance, it can definitely help improve your cardiovascular endurance. Also has students dance with partners works the affective domain and when they think about the steps, it covers the cognitive aspect too! Dance is a lifetime activity and a great way to stay fit and make friends as well!
